Volunteers Needed For Newbold Disc Golf Work

commons.wikimedia.org

Work is progressing on a new disc golf course planned off Ole Lake road in the town of Newbold and folks helping to construct the course need volunteers Saturday.

Last year, the town just north of Rhinelander announced they were building course with completion expected by fall. The logging has been done, but town resident Pete Cody says a volunteer work crew is needed. He says they've been getting rid of left over brush....

"....twenty would be great, 30 would be a lot better. The work we'll ask them to do is help pile brush and do some raking. We'll have some small trees that we have to put in the ground so there will be plenty of work to do...."

Cody says they need help to have the course ready to go this fall.....

"....it's speculation at this time. It just depends on how well the work goes and how quickly get the stumps out of the ground there and get the T-pads in and the baskets out. It will require a lot of work. We're not of the opinion that it will go real fast. We want to make sure everything is done right...."

If you have an extra leaf rake, it would be appreciated. Ole Lake Road is about five miles north of Rhinelander, off Highway 47. The crew will assemble at 10 a.m. Cody says they have a Facebook site, Friends of the Newbold Outdoor Recreation Area or you can call Cody for more information at 715-369-0309.
